2012-05-18 2 views
-3

OpenGL ES 1.1과 함께 2 차원 안드로이드 게임을 만들고 있는데 게임 엔진을 사용하지 않습니다. 자체 프레임 워크를 사용하고 있습니다.OpenGL ES 1.1 게임에서 멋진 GUI 효과를 만들려면 어떻게해야합니까?

사람들이 멋진 게임을 만드는 방법에 대해 궁금해합니다. 게임의 모든 부분이 그리기 전용입니까?

또한 화면간에 멋진 전환을 만들 수있는 방법은 무엇입니까?이를위한 라이브러리 또는 방법은 무엇일까요?

편집 : 그가 비디오를 볼 때 화면 사이에 전환이 있습니다. 화면 사이의 전환을 의미합니다. 당신은 멋진 GUI를 원하는 경우

http://youtu.be/JdfgGMBvqTk?t=4m54s

+0

_ 자체 프레임 워크를 사용하고 있습니다. - 사전 테스트 된 라이브러리 (일명 엔진)로 시작하십시오. 당신이 프레임 워크를 팔거나 숙제를하고 싶지 않으면 그렇게하는 것이 더 쉽습니다;) –

+0

나는 그것을 배우기를 원하며 라이센스 비용을 지불하고 싶지 않습니다. – droidmachine

+0

게임 엔진이 어떻게 끝났습니까? – Antinous

답변

3

, 나는 당신의 김프 또는 PS 능력이 충분하지 않을 경우 당신은 그래픽 디자이너와 접촉에 들어갈 좋습니다. 전환은 코드와 그래픽의 조합입니다. 당신은 그걸 가지고 놀아야 할 것입니다. 예. 전환은 게임을 만들 때와 같은 방식으로 이루어집니다.

+0

게임의 GUI는 애니메이션과 같습니다. – droidmachine

+2

예, GUI에 전환 효과를 적용하려면 애니메이션과 같습니다. –

0

사람들이 게임 "GUI"에 대해 이야기 할 때 그들은 보통 HUD 또는 게임 그래픽에 대해 이야기합니다. HUD는 게임 (버튼, 메뉴, 카운터 등)을 오버레이하는 인터페이스입니다. 게임 그래픽은 지형, 게임 캐릭터, 무기 등을 그리는 데 사용되는 이미지입니다. 둘 다 아티스트가 그려 내고 게임에 넣는 방법을 알아야하는 프로그래머에게 제공됩니다. Artur가 제공 한 조언을 따르고 오픈 소스 게임 엔진을 배우는 것이 좋습니다. 게임을 디자인하는 방법을 배우게되며 게임을 훨씬 더 빠르게 프로그래밍하는 방법을 배우게됩니다. 여기에 나열된 안드로이드 용 무료 게임 엔진은 수십 가지가 있습니다. http://www.mobilegameengines.com/android

관련 문제